The brane cosmology has invoked new challenges to the usual Big Bang
cosmology. In this paper we present a brief account on thermal history of the
post-inflationary brane cosmology. We have realized that it is not obvious that
the post-inflationary brane cosmology would always deviate from the standard
Big Bang cosmology. However, if it deviates some stringent conditions on the
brane tension are to be satisfied. In this regard we study various implications
on gravitino production and its abundance. We discuss Affleck-Dine mechanism
for baryogenesis and make some comments on moduli and dilaton problems in this
